titleOfInvention Orthotic system
abstract An orthosis (3) includes a footplate (5) having a heel portion (15), a midfoot portion (13), and a longitudinal axis (21) extending between the heel portion (15) and midfoot portion (13). A first deflection zone (22) is defined along a length of the footplate (5) anterior of the heel portion (15) and through which the footplate (5) is arranged to flex during gait to accommodate dorsiflexion of a foot of a user positioned on the footplate. At least one strut (9) is connected to the heel portion (15) of the footplate (5) and extends upwardly therefrom and a connecting portion (9a) connects the at least one strut (9) to the heel portion (15).
